St. Elizabeth's Cathedral is the largest church in Slovakia and the easternmost gothic cathedral in Europe, built between 1378 and 1508. Visitors are awed by the monumental main façade, the precious late-gothic winged altar of St. Elizabeth, the royal oratory and the crypt of Francis II Rákóczi. You can also climb the north tower for a view over the city's rooftops and surrounding hills.
